Question 50 - An aqueous solution with 2.5 g of a protein dissolved in 600 cubic centimeters of a solution at 20 degree Celsius was placed in a container that has a water-permeable membrane. Water permeated through the membrane until the h - level of the solution was 0.9 cm above the pure water. (a) Calculate the absolute temperature of the solution, T in Kelvin, where T (Kelvin) = T (degree Celsius) + 273.15. (b) Calculate the osmotic pressure, P of the solution by using the formula P = hrg where h is level of the solution, r is density of water with 1000 kg per cubic meter, g = 9.81 N / kg as gravitational acceleration. (c) Calculate the concentration of the protein solution, C in kg / cubic meter. (d) Calculate the molecular weight of the protein, (MW) = CRT / P where R = 8.314 Pa cubic meter / (mol K) as ideal gas constant.

ACCOUNTING AND FINANCIAL ENGINEERING - EXAMPLE 34.29 : An engineering company that produces small biochemical tools applies Installment Sales Method in its accounting. Let A = Installment Sales, B = Cost of Installment Sales, C = Gross Profit, D = Gross Profit Ratio. In year 20X8, let A = $400, B = $250, C = $150. In year 20X9, let A = $450, B = $315, C = $135. If the value of D = 37.5 % in year 20X8 : (a) find the value of D for year 20X9; (b) calculate the realized gross profit = ED / 100, for year 20X8 when the cash collected from sales is E = $100.
